| I'm just now beginning to develop an interest in the small scale stuff. I am interested to know who's got the best products in this range. |
INVHO, they are:
1/400 - Big Bird, GeminiJets, AeroClassics, Pheonix, Aurora, and Seattle Model Aircraft Company (apparently now defunct)
1/500 - StarJets and Inflight (which just introduced a 1/500 line)
For me, GJ offers the best value for the buck. AeroClassics is mostly excellent, but with occasional clunkers (their Connie is superb). StarJets is top quality (no one better), and the new Inflight 1/500 line looks just as good (though I haven't ordered from that line--yet).
I think Herpa is considered the leader in the 1/500 line (and maybe 1/400), and they have huge offerings in other scales (see the list at diecastairplane). However, I don't like Herpa because of the plastic wings, and some of their early 1/500 offerings look kinda chintzy.
The 1/200 and 1/250 scales are getting popular, but they are very expensive.
My favorite dealers are JetCollector, diecastairplane, and eztoys. All of these have good service, good stock, and trustworthy organizations. However, there are dozens of good dealers out there, so it pays to look around. The best database available for these models is Wings900. They now have a list of almost all the diecast airliners ever made, and if you register, you can create a comprehensive database of your own collection which can be either kept private or shared with the community.
